Chemicals Used for Wastewater Treatment


Wastewater treatment is a crucial process aimed at improving water quality by eliminating contaminants and pollutants. Various chemicals play critical roles in this process, facilitating the breakdown of harmful substances and ensuring that treated water meets environmental standards before being released back into natural water bodies or reused. This article explores the essential chemicals used in wastewater treatment, their functions, and their importance in ensuring safe and effective management of wastewater.


One of the primary categories of chemicals used in wastewater treatment is coagulants. These substances, such as aluminum sulfate (alum) and ferric chloride, are instrumental in aggregation of suspended particles in wastewater. When added to the treatment process, coagulants destabilize the colloidal particles, allowing them to clump together into larger aggregates known as flocs. This floc formation increases the efficiency of sedimentation processes, making it easier to remove solid waste from the water. Coagulation is often the first step in a multi-stage treatment process, setting the stage for further purification.


Another significant group of chemicals includes flocculants, which are used along with coagulants to enhance the settling of solids. Common flocculants, such as polyacrylamide, can help to bind the smaller flocs together, creating larger aggregates that settle more quickly in sedimentation tanks. This step is crucial in achieving clear effluent and maximizing the efficiency of the treatment system.


pH adjustment chemicals are also vital in the wastewater treatment process. Acids and bases, like sulfuric acid or sodium hydroxide, are employed to control the pH levels of the wastewater. Maintaining an optimal pH range is essential because it can significantly influence the effectiveness of chemical reactions used in the treatment process. For instance, many biological treatment methods function best within a specific pH range, and improper pH can inhibit microbial activity, slowing down the treatment process and leading to lower effluent quality.

Disinfectants like chlorine, ozone, and ultraviolet (UV) light are employed at the final stages of wastewater treatment. These chemicals are crucial for the elimination of pathogens and harmful microorganisms that might persist after other treatment processes. Chlorination is one of the most common methods, but concerns over the formation of harmful disinfection byproducts have led to increased use of alternatives like UV light and ozone, which are effective without the associated risks.


In addition to these primary chemicals, various other specialty chemicals are used, including odor control agents, dechlorination agents, and corrosion inhibitors. Each of these plays a supportive role in addressing specific challenges associated with wastewater treatment.


The choice of chemicals in wastewater treatment depends on multiple factors, including the characteristics of the influent water and regulatory requirements. As the focus on environmental sustainability grows, the industry is increasingly investing in innovative and greener chemical solutions, aiming to reduce toxicity and improve overall treatment efficiency.


In conclusion, chemicals used in wastewater treatment are integral to protecting public health and preserving natural ecosystems. By employing coagulants, flocculants, pH adjusters, and disinfectants, wastewater treatment facilities can effectively minimize the harmful impact of wastewater on the environment. Continuous advancements in chemical formulations promise to enhance the sustainability and effectiveness of these essential processes.
